For the duration of the warm days of summer at Spring Valley State Park highs are regularly in the 80's. Summer overnight lows descend down to the 40's. The winter comes with highs in the 40's, and after the sun is down all through the wintertime temperatures at Spring Valley State Park sink into the 0's.
Spring Valley
    State Park is generally a relatively dried out place; September is the wettest month with most rain; January is when it's the driest. There are so many fun things to do for everybody to like.
